downer

noun

down·​er ˈdau̇-nər How to pronounce downer (audio)
1
: a weak, sick, or crippled animal in shipment that is down and cannot get up
often used attributively
a downer cow
2
: a depressant drug
especially : barbiturate
3
: someone or something depressing, disagreeable, or unsatisfactory

Word History

First Known Use

1886, in the meaning defined at sense 1
